What Is a USDA Loan?

USDA loan is a type of home loan guaranteed by the United States Department of Agriculture (USDA). This type of financing is particularly beneficial for low to moderate-income borrowers in Alabama who might face challenges qualifying for conventional mortgages.

USDA rural development loans in Alabama offer several key features that set them apart from conventional home loans. One of the most notable advantages is the potential for 100% financing, which means eligible borrowers can secure a home without needing a down payment. This no down payment mortgage option makes homeownership more attainable for many Alabama residents who might otherwise struggle to save for a high upfront cost.

These low-income mortgage loans typically have competitive interest rates and flexible credit requirements. The USDA guarantees part of the loan, allowing lenders to offer borrowers more favorable terms. This government backing also means that private mortgage insurance (PMI) is not required, potentially resulting in lower monthly payments for homeowners.

However, while USDA loans don’t require private mortgage insurance (PMI), they include a guarantee fee. This fee serves a similar purpose to PMI but is typically less expensive. For USDA loans in Alabama, the guarantee fee consists of two parts:

  1. An upfront guarantee fee: The upfront fee is 1% of the total loan amount. This amount can be financed into the loan.
  2. An annual guarantee fee: The annual fee is 0.35% of your remaining balance. This amount is paid monthly as part of the mortgage payment.

It’s important to note that USDA loans are specifically intended for properties in designated rural areas. However, the definition of “rural” is broader than many people might expect, encompassing many suburban neighborhoods and small towns throughout Alabama.

Benefits of USDA Loans

USDA loans offer several attractive benefits, making them a compelling option for many Alabama home buyers. Here are some of the key advantages of choosing an Alabama USDA loan:

  • No down payment: Eligible borrowers can finance 100% of the home’s purchase price. This feature allows individuals and families to become homeowners without saving for a large upfront payment.
  • Competitive interest rates: USDA loans often come with relatively low interest rates since they’re backed by the government.
  • Flexible credit requirements: The credit score minimums for USDA loans are typically more lenient than those for traditional loans. This flexibility makes homeownership more accessible to borrowers who may have less-than-perfect credit histories.
  • No PMI: Unlike many low down payment mortgage options, USDA loans don’t require private mortgage insurance. The absence of PMI can lead to lower monthly payments for homeowners.
  • Lower fees: The USDA guarantee fee is usually less expensive than mortgage insurance on other types of loans. This reduction in fees can make USDA loans a more affordable option for many borrowers.

How to Qualify for a USDA Home Loan in Alabama

Qualifying for a USDA home loan in Alabama involves meeting specific criteria set by both the USDA and individual lenders.   • Income limits: Household income must not exceed 115% of the area’s median income. This limit varies by location and family size within Alabama.
  • Property location: The home must be in a USDA-designated rural area. Many suburban areas in Alabama may qualify, so it’s worth checking specific addresses.
  • Citizenship status: Applicants must be U.S. citizens, non-citizen nationals, or qualified resident aliens.
  • Credit score: The USDA doesn’t set a minimum credit score but lenders often require a credit score of at least 600, although this figure can vary by lender.
  • Primary residence: The property purchased with the loan must serve as your primary residence.
  • Property condition: The home must meet certain safety and livability standards the USDA sets.
  • Loan repayment ability: You must demonstrate the ability to manage the loan payments along with other financial obligations.

How to Apply for a USDA Loan in Alabama

Applying for a USDA loan in Alabama is a straightforward process, similar to applying for any other type of mortgage. In fact, many borrowers find it just as simple as conventional loan applications. Here’s an overview of the steps involved in securing a USDA home loan in Alabama:

  1. Gather necessary documents: Collect required paperwork, such as proof of income, tax returns, bank statements, and identification documents.
  2. Choose a USDA-approved lender: Select a lender experienced with USDA rural development Alabama loans.
  3. Submit your loan application: Complete the lender’s application form and provide all requested documentation.
  4. Property selection: If you haven’t already, find a property that meets USDA guidelines in an eligible area.
  5. Home appraisal: The lender will order an appraisal to ensure the property meets USDA standards and to determine its value.
  6. Underwriting process: The lender reviews your application and supporting documents to make a decision.
  7. Closing: Once approved, you’ll attend a closing meeting and receive the keys to your new home.
